Good value for a private twin room with ground based beds. and a desk.Fairly quiet. Clean bathroom. Very nice to have a reading light attached to the headboard. Fun entertainment facilities with TV, pool table.Staff are at front desk 24/7.

No bread in the kitchen for breakfast toast. No milk for cereal.. Lots of street noise from the nearby pubs as our room faced the street. Bring earplugs. Very flat single pillow.

The location is good, within approximately 15 minutes walking distance from the city centre. Many tourist attractions to visit nearby too. The staff was excellent with a 24hour reception open. Very clean premises and a well-equipped and specious kitchen and a large common area with pool table and television.

The hostel is located near bars and restaurants and it gets quite noisy during the night. I was pretty unlucky with my roommates too, they were really annoying and disrespectful but this is clearly a matter of luck, the staff of the hostel can’t do anything about that.

no bunks, so you can sit on your bed & no climbing-cage underneath for valuables, hanging rail with hangers for clothes, shower/lloo in room with extra in hallway. Kitchen well equipped & free coffee/tea free, with lots of seating, lounge room with pool table books TV etc. Loads of pubs & food venues nearby, Right near St Lukes bombed out church. Overall a great place and good value.

Room 5 Currently building works going on next door & pub empyting bottles late at night., I think other rooms may not be affected Also a bit of an uphill walk from the Dock area. Buses do pass by,

The staff were amazing, really helpful and friendly throughout my stay. Towel hire of £1 was reasonable as was luggage storage for £1. Came for Comic Con at the Exhibition Centre, this was a 20-30 minute straight-forward walk away, also a 10 minute walk from Liverpool Lime Street Station. Bedroom was a decent size and clean with a decent bathroom. Travelled as a solo female and I felt safe the entire time I was here.

Sound-proofing could be a bit better I guess but I don't go to a hostel expecting a perfect nights sleep

The staff were friendly and helped us with anything we needed. It is in a great location where Liverpool centre is about 10mins walk away. The rooms were basic but looked exactly like the pictures and were clean. There was a common room with a pool table and TV and kitchen which had all the necessary items (kettle, tea and coffee, utensils).

The bathroom showers and sinks are a little dated however they were clean. Although the beds were comfortable, the pillows were a quite flat.
